        AN  ACT  to  amend the tax law, in relation to the tax treatment of farm
          income of certain farm business taxpayers
 
          The People of the State of New York, represented in Senate and  Assem-
        bly, do enact as follows:
 
     1    Section  1.  Paragraph  39 of subsection (c) of section 612 of the tax
     2  law, as added by section 1 of part Y of chapter 59 of the laws of  2013,
     3  is amended to read as follows:
     4    (39)  (A)  In  the  case of a taxpayer who is a small business who has
     5  business income [and/or farm income] as  defined  in  the  laws  of  the
     6  United  States,  an  amount  equal  to three percent of the net items of
     7  income, gain, loss and deduction attributable to such business [or farm]
     8  entering into federal adjusted gross income, but not less than zero, for
     9  taxable years beginning after two thousand thirteen, an amount equal  to
    10  three  and three-quarters percent of the net items of income, gain, loss
    11  and deduction attributable to such  business  [or  farm]  entering  into
    12  federal adjusted gross income, but not less than zero, for taxable years
    13  beginning  after  two  thousand  fourteen,  and  an amount equal to five
    14  percent of the net items of income, gain, loss and  deduction  attribut-
    15  able  to  such  business  [or farm] entering into federal adjusted gross
    16  income, but not less than zero, for taxable years  beginning  after  two
    17  thousand  fifteen.  For  the  purposes of this paragraph, the term small
    18  business shall mean a sole proprietor [or a farm business]  who  employs
    19  one  or  more  persons  during the taxable year and who has net business
    20  income [or net farm income] of less  than  two  hundred  fifty  thousand
    21  dollars.

     1    (B) In the case of a taxpayer who is a farm business or a taxpayer who
     2  is  a  member,  partner,  or shareholder of a limited liability company,
     3  partnership, or New York S corporation, respectively,  that  is  a  farm
     4  business,  who  or  which  has farm income as defined by the laws of the
     5  United  States,  an  amount  equal to twenty percent of the net items of
     6  income, gain, loss and deduction attributable  to  such  farm.  For  the
     7  purposes  of  this  paragraph,  the term farm business shall mean a farm
     8  business that has net farm income of less than three hundred fifty thou-
     9  sand dollars.
    10    § 2. This act shall take effect immediately and shall apply to taxable
    11  years beginning on or after January 1, 2019.
